Alright I think I figured out your problem. Unless you have something actually malfunctioning I believe what your seeing is due to you having "Sensor On" in the menu system. Holding the device horizontal it will blink the arrow < or > to indicate it's going to make an adjustment because the gravity sensor is enabled. You could either set "Sensor Off" or you could try holding the device with the battery tube where the SXMini Logo is at bottom and OLED screen facing straight upward while you look straight down to adjust, tilting either direction will cause the sensor to attempt to adjust which is what I think your seeing.

Does not appear to be a Global setting it's independent of each other Configuration. I'm betting you set it in one Configuration but not all. I don't think it's a firmware flaw or that your devices are faulty. Go through all 5 Configurations and set them each to "Sensor Off" then if it changes report back. :)
